Former Square CTO Bob Lee Stabbed to Death in Downtown San Francisco
Bob Lee, the former chief technology officer of Square, was identified as the 43-year-old man stabbed to death in Downtown San Francisco early Tuesday morning. Madison Square Garden Entertainment’s Board Reaches $85M Deal to Settle Shareholder Suit
Logo text Madison Square Garden Entertainment’s board has agreed to settle for $85 million a shareholder suit accusing it of failing to protect stockholders’ interests when it merged with MSG Networks. Two Counties Square Off With California Over Mental Health Duties
SACRAMENTO, Calif. — Sacramento and Solano counties are in a standoff with the state over mental health coverage for a portion of Medicaid patients in those counties — a dispute that threatens to disrupt care for nearly 50,000 low-income residents receiving treatment for severe mental illness.
